what's the "standard" way to mutli-track the patterns you make in the 606?

for example, if i wanted to record a 606 pattern with 8 sequenced sounds into pro tools, how would that be done?

i don't want all 8 sounds to be recorded into one stereo track...i want each of the 8 sounds to have their own track in pro tools so i can mix them appropriately.

You can try to pan out the samples, like sound 1 panned hard left and sound 2 hard right then record them in PT as mono, two tracks at a time.
